Around 2:30 this Thursday afternoon the community reported a new incident of insecurity. In videos from surveillance cameras of the complexes located in an exclusive sector of the north of Bogotá (on Carrera 7A between streets 146 and 147) recorded as four men aboard two motorcycles attempted to commit what authorities said could have been an attempt at freight.

The men fled on their motorcycles while opening fire on the citizens who were in the sector. No injuries reported.

According to the preliminary version of the authorities, the victims would have been robbed of the sum of 10 million pesos. It is presumed that the criminals were following them from the Unicentro shopping center.

In the videos that the residents of the sector also recorded, it was evident how the men got off the motorcycle and pointed their guns at a man who was inside a black truck.

At that moment, They steal the money and flee on motorcycles after engaging in an exchange of fire with some citizens who were in the area. It was recorded how the four men fled on the motorcycles, although it was only one who committed the robbery.

The authorities told this newspaper that, according to the victim’s statement, he had left the Unicentro shopping center after exchanging nearly 10 million pesos in dollars when he was followed and held at gunpoint by the criminals. The victim claims that the exchange house where he made the transaction could be involved.

What does the victim say?

Carlos Monroy, victim of the events, told this newspaper that he noticed strange movements that occurred in the exchange house where he was making the transaction. ““I was in an exchange house on Carrera 15 and Calle 119 and I did see suspicious actions, but I never imagined that they were following me.”

Although he says that he cannot affirm or deny the participation of the exchange house, he does assure that everything was very suspicious.

“I’m not sure about the exchange house but, yes, everything was very strange because the transaction took a long time and there were guys outside watching a lot. I’m sure that if they check the security cameras at the exchange house they will identify the person. two guys who had their backs turned and another who was facing them (…) I don’t know to what degree there is complicity and it is up to the authorities to investigate, but there is something to see,” Carlos said.

According to the man’s story, when he arrived at the entrance of his building he had to wait because the vehicle entrance door was closed and he had to announce himself and wait for them to let him through. “When I arrived and got careless, I did notice that a man got off the motorcycle with the revolver and when I turned my head to see where my wife wasanother man had her pointed at her through the window,” the victim said.

Monroy assured that after the events the security workers from the exclusive surrounding residential complexes went out to try to control the situation and that was when the exchange of shots began. “Fortunately, it was just the money and my wife, my son and I who were inside the vehicle. We are fine and it didn’t happen any further.”
